Wurfl php zend download

Thanks for contributing an answer to stack overflow. Wurfl wireless universal resource file is a set of proprietary application programming interfaces apis and an xml configuration file which contains information about device capabilities and features for a variety of mobile devices, focused on mobile device detection. It can do this with no interruptions to serving requests. You may download the release from the following location. Brian will demonstrate how you can leverage the wireless universal resource file wurfl, php, imagemagick, ffmpeg, and other open source tools to optimize content for consumption on mobile devices. Contribute to baluptonzend frameworkmirror development by creating an account on github. Create library folder under project root directory. Wurfl php api libraries, gpl versions dotkernel psr15. Imageengine is an automatic image optimizer built on wurfl device detection. Make a note of where you install the library terawurfl. Step 3 create folder data wurfl cache under project root directory. Developers should use this documentation to correctly implement scientiamobiles imageengine image resizing cdn and wurfl device detection solutions for mobile optimization and analytics. Dec 08, 2010 i have been working with the eclipse pdt editor for quite a while now and it impressed me so much that it became my primary editor.

In this short guide, i will show you how to implement the the php device detection api into a zend framework project running on a zend application server. Im following the tutorial on setting up wurfl with zend framework to enable easy mobile browser detection. A list of all the packages can be found in the documentation page. Zend server free install windows server spiceworks. Contains conversion of zf1 subversion repo to git, from version 15234 forward, and only containing master and release1. Download wireless universal resource file for free.

On march 22, 2012 it was announced by matthew weier ophinney that zend. Net, or php is available under a 30 days evaluation license for users who have registered for an account. Download wurfl php api and unzip it into folder wurfl php 1. Mobile development with zend framework and wurfl php. The integration of wurfl into dotkernel is described below. To enable wurfl on your application you must register for a free account on and download the latest release from your file manager.

Mar 31, 2014 if you would like to upgrade a zend server older than 5. Aug 05, 20 zend optimizer has been updated and renamed to zend guard since php 5. The terawurfl useragent features adapter zend framework. Browse other questions tagged php zend framework2 download or ask your own question. The package comes with an xml file containing wurfl device capabilities. Build mobile apps with zend framework and zend studio.

Zend optimizer greatly enhances the performance of php applications. Inside of your project folder, run the following command. Great video that was posted today on the zend developer zone, check it out. Sep 25, 2008 brian will demonstrate how you can leverage the wireless universal resource file wurfl, php, imagemagick, ffmpeg, and other open source tools to optimize content for consumption on mobile devices. To mark the fact that the wurfl file is now delivered to the community of wurfl adopters with a license, everyone who intends to download the file should observe that the following conditions now apply and accept those prior to deplyment or use of the wurfl file and data. Wurfl lets you detect thousands of types of mobile devices accessing your web service and take decisions based on what that device can or cannot do. The phpmysql based terawurfl api comes with a remote webservice that allows you to. Zend debugger install zend debugger zend php debugger.

Wurfl with zend framework ignoring cache directory configuration. Wurfl php api libraries, gpl versions dotkernel php application framework. The api also performs rigorous caching, leading to. Development tools downloads zend server community edition by zend technologies and many more programs are available for instant and free download. Download php for applications php framework for free.

Luca passani, author and lead of the wurfl project, has provided an exemption to zend framework to provide a nongpl adapter accessing the wurfl php api. Jun 27, 2012 i have situation to create site for both mobile and deskop. The zend optimizer is a service that runs the files encoded by the zend encoder. Watch this video to see how you can use zend framework and eclipsebased tools available. Php5 rad and object oriented php framework for building eventdriven stateful web applications. Exception while setting up the wurfl in zend stack overflow. Wurfl onsites xml updater can automatically check for a new device data xml snapshot from your customer vault, download, and reload the engine. Wurfl will detect the device capabilities, including screen size and image format support, resize and optimize the image accordingly. Put up site is down for maintenance page on our site. Zend optimizer is a free application that allows php to run files encoded by zend guard. The zend debugger is a php extension which can be installed on a web server to enable the debugging of php scripts. While the wurfl cloud is a paid service, a free offer is made available to hobbyists and microcompanies for use on mobile sites with limited traffic. Watch this video to see how you can use zend framework and eclipsebased tools available for zend studio to develop a php based mobile application. I have situation to create site for both mobile and deskop.

Rickroll to go with php, wurfl, and other open source tools. Includes device data snapshot with 15 wurfl capabilities. A php extension which should be installed on your web server in order to perform optimal remote debugging and profiling using zend studio. Currently, the wurfl cloud supports java, microsoft. Zend server is the best way to run php apps on azure with fully supported php runtime and dev tools.

The wurfl api does no normalization, and expects it to be there at this point, everything is setup. Hundreds of thousands of mobile applications are available. Upgrading php versions can only be performed on zend server 6. Zend server on azure is designed for both development and production. The zend framework project ceased creation of distribution tarballszip files for releases starting with the 2. Im using the old codeplex version of php manager, so perhaps these steps dont apply if youre using the recently revamped version. Useragent options manual documentation zend framework. It appears that zend framework currently only works with wurfl version 1.

It can be used freely by anyone looking to run encoded. However, you might still have some older projects running php 5. Although this article has been written with zend server in mind, the principals will apply to any other php compatible application server. We will continue to create and provide them for the 2. Build mobile apps with zend framework and zend studio mobile applications are booming. Source code encoding and obfuscation for protection from unlicensed use and redistribution. Zend server download and other zend downloads zend by. Currently, ships with adapters for the wurfl wireless universal resource file api, terawurfl, and deviceatlas. Learn about your php and zend server support options and access our php and zend server download page. If you are a customer, you can access the customer support portal from this page. Due to the changes in licensing of wurfl, we have removed the wurflapi. The first request from a mobile device will populate the wurfl cache by parsing the resources wurfl. Visit the zend pdt website for more information version. We decided to move the api downloads to our own scientiamobile site for greater control and consistency.

We will continue to offer the wurfl onsite apis free of charge via the scientiamobile site to all who use the api under the affero gpl version 3 agpl v3 license. Zend studio php formatter file for dotkernel coding standard. With wurfl, you can optimize mobile web content, effectively deliver advertisements, or analyze mobile traffic. Previously, all of our api downloads were hosted on. It includes new components like a json rpc server, a xml to json converter, psr7 functionality, and compatibility with php 7. Find device type using zend framework developer notes. Download a release archive from wurfl site and extract it to a directory suitable for your application. Unfortunately, only the latest 2 versions are available and the older versions were pulled for some reason and are not available for download from sourceforge.

When mentioning the document root of your web server, we are referring to the.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. This post refers to dotkernel 1, based on zend framework 1. Alternately, all zend framework packages can be installed individually. Terawurfl parses the wurfl database into a mysql database, and provides an. Mar 01, 2017 contribute to zendframeworkzendpdf development by creating an account on github. Once registered, and once a trial is enabled, users will have access to download wurfl onsite components including api and xml files from within their account vault. For a list of limitations and known issues, see zend servers release notes.

Wurfl wireless universal resource file is a set of proprietary application programming. This class provides a features adapter that utilizes the wurfl php api in order to discover mobile device capabilities to inject into useragent device instances. The following official gnupg keys of the current php release manager can be used to verify the tags. Once registered, users will have access to download wurfl onsite components including api and xml files from within their account vault. Terawurfl parses the wurfl database into a mysql database, and provides an api for querying that database for mobile device capabilies. Ssh into the server and copy library zend to pathtowebapplibrary and call the folder something like zend 1. May 15, 20 download php for applications php framework for free. The releases are tagged and signed in the php git repository. Currently, zend framework ships with adapters for the wurfl wireless universal resource file api, tera wurfl, and deviceatlas, with more planned for the future. Configuring zend debugger downloading and installing zend debugger. The wurfl useragent features adapter zend framework. Free runtime application that enables php to run the scripts encoded by zend guard. Based on zend framework, features tableless html, multiple databases, accesskey support, auto data type recognition, transparent ajax, utf8, i18nl10n. Asking for help, clarification, or responding to other answers.

Download the zend debugger package which corresponds to your operating system locate the zenddebugger. Scientiamobile offers commercial users of wurfl weekly updates to the. Once you have downloaded the latest release, extract the files to be accessible from your php enabled webserver. This class can parse wurlf xml files to lookup for the capabilities of mobile device given its user agent string. Currently, zend framework ships with adapters for the wurfl wireless universal resource. The api also performs rigorous caching, leading to excellent performance. Terawurfl parses the wurfl database into a mysql database, and provides an api for querying that database for mobile device.

The class can extract several types of details about a given mobile device, like the supported gui extensions, whether it supports wap, ring tone support, etc the class can parse a wurfl file and cache its information to avoid the parsing overhead next time the information is. The standard zend runtime compiler used by php is indeed very fast, generating. Wurfl wireless universal resource file is a database of mobile device capabilities. Once you download tera wurfl and extract it, edit terawurflconfig. Get your zend server download and download other zend software including zend studio, zend guard, zend guard loader, and zend studio web debugger. I dont use the php config file as i prefer not to mix in. It is the best way to create higher performing applications, and the best way to run mission critical php applications in the cloud.

1100 90 290 1145 1434 508 522 1183 18 1399 268 364 1026 949 71 1033 1205 1495 722 525 306 225 1157 791 736 1216 1331 1480 1354 1240 593 598 556 1467